江西制造職業技術學院《計算智能導論》2023-2024學年第二學期期末試卷_第1頁
江西制造職業技術學院《計算智能導論》2023-2024學年第二學期期末試卷_第2頁
江西制造職業技術學院《計算智能導論》2023-2024學年第二學期期末試卷_第3頁
江西制造職業技術學院《計算智能導論》2023-2024學年第二學期期末試卷_第4頁
江西制造職業技術學院《計算智能導論》2023-2024學年第二學期期末試卷_第5頁
已閱讀5頁,還剩2頁未讀 繼續免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

裝訂線裝訂線PAGE2第1頁,共3頁江西制造職業技術學院《計算智能導論》

2023-2024學年第二學期期末試卷院(系)_______班級_______學號_______姓名_______題號一二三四總分得分一、單選題(本大題共25個小題,每小題1分,共25分.在每小題給出的四個選項中,只有一項是符合題目要求的.)1、在操作系統的進程通信中,共享內存是一種高效的方式。假設有兩個進程P1和P2通過共享內存進行通信,以下關于共享內存通信的描述中,正確的是:()A.共享內存區域的大小是固定的,不能動態調整B.進程P1和P2對共享內存的訪問是互斥的,避免了數據沖突C.共享內存通信需要操作系統提供額外的同步機制來保證數據的一致性D.共享內存通信只適用于同一臺計算機上的進程,不能用于不同計算機之間的進程通信2、考慮一個具有多個進程的系統,進程之間存在資源競爭。假設有資源R1、R2和R3,進程P1已經占用了資源R1,進程P2已經占用了資源R2,進程P3申請資源R1和R2。此時系統處于什么狀態?()A.安全狀態B.不安全狀態C.死鎖狀態D.無法確定3、在操作系統的存儲管理中,段頁式存儲管理結合了段式和頁式存儲管理的優點。假設一個程序被分為多個段,每個段又被分為多個頁。以下關于段頁式存儲管理的地址轉換過程的描述,正確的是:()A.首先進行段的地址轉換,然后進行頁的地址轉換B.先進行頁的地址轉換,再進行段的地址轉換C.段和頁的地址轉換同時進行,以提高效率D.地址轉換過程只需要進行一次,無需區分段和頁4、在操作系統的磁盤管理中,磁盤調度算法的選擇對于磁盤的I/O性能有著重要的影響。除了前面提到的幾種常見算法,還有電梯調度算法。電梯調度算法類似于電梯的工作原理,總是沿著一個方向移動,直到該方向上沒有請求為止,然后改變方向。假設磁盤請求隊列的順序為82、170、43、140、24、16、190,磁頭當前位于50號磁道,初始移動方向為磁道號增加的方向。那么,采用電梯調度算法時,磁頭移動的總磁道數為()A.382B.418C.450D.5125、操作系統的進程調度算法對于系統性能有很大影響。以下關于進程調度算法的描述中,哪個選項是錯誤的?()A.先來先服務調度算法按照進程到達的先后順序進行調度B.短作業優先調度算法優先調度執行時間短的進程C.時間片輪轉調度算法將CPU時間劃分為固定大小的時間片,每個進程輪流執行一個時間片D.高響應比優先調度算法只考慮進程的等待時間,不考慮執行時間6、在一個實時操作系統中,有多個任務具有不同的截止時間和優先級。任務T1的截止時間為100毫秒,優先級為高;任務T2的截止時間為200毫秒,優先級為中;任務T3的截止時間為300毫秒,優先級為低。假設系統當前處于空閑狀態,然后這三個任務依次到達。如果系統采用基于優先級的搶占式調度算法,那么任務的執行順序是怎樣的?同時分析這種調度算法在滿足實時任務截止時間方面的可靠性和可能存在的問題。A.T1->T2->T3B.T1->T3->T2C.T2->T1->T3D.T3->T2->T17、在一個多處理器操作系統中,進程可以在不同的處理器上并行執行。假設系統中有四個處理器,進程P1、P2、P3和P4同時就緒。以下關于多處理器操作系統進程調度的描述中,正確的是:()A.操作系統會將這四個進程平均分配到四個處理器上執行,以保證負載均衡B.進程調度的策略與單處理器操作系統完全相同,不需要考慮處理器的數量C.為了充分利用多處理器資源,操作系統可能會將一個進程的不同部分分配到不同的處理器上執行D.如果進程P1是計算密集型,而進程P2是I/O密集型,操作系統會優先將P1分配到處理器上執行8、在操作系統的虛擬內存管理中,頁面置換算法的選擇會影響系統的性能。假設系統采用最近最少使用(LRU)頁面置換算法。當內存已滿且需要置換頁面時,以下關于頁面選擇的描述,正確的是:()A.會選擇最長時間未被訪問的頁面進行置換B.隨機選擇一個頁面進行置換C.選擇剛剛被訪問過的頁面進行置換D.選擇最先進入內存的頁面進行置換9、在一個具有實時時鐘的操作系統中,時鐘中斷是系統進行時間管理和任務調度的重要依據。假設系統的時鐘中斷頻率為100Hz,分析時鐘中斷對系統性能的影響,包括中斷處理的開銷和對任務執行的干擾等,并討論如何合理設置時鐘中斷頻率以平衡系統的時間精度和性能,以及在不同應用場景下的最佳實踐。A.時鐘中斷頻率越高越好B.時鐘中斷頻率越低越好C.存在一個最優的時鐘中斷頻率D.時鐘中斷頻率的影響不大10、操作系統中的死鎖問題是一個重要的研究課題。假設有三個進程P1、P2和P3,它們分別需要資源A、B和C。目前,P1占用了資源A,P2占用了資源B,P3占用了資源C,并且它們都在請求對方占用的資源。以下關于死鎖的描述中,正確的是:()A.這種情況一定會導致死鎖,因為三個進程都無法繼續執行B.死鎖的發生是因為資源分配不當和進程推進順序不合理C.只要其中一個進程釋放其占用的資源,就可以避免死鎖的發生D.操作系統可以通過預先分配所有資源的方式來完全避免死鎖的出現11、在操作系統的進程同步中,信號量是一種常用的同步工具。信號量可以分為整型信號量和記錄型信號量。整型信號量存在“忙等”問題,而記錄型信號量則通過阻塞和喚醒操作避免了這一問題。假設有兩個進程P1和P2,它們共享一個緩沖區,P1負責向緩沖區寫入數據,P2負責從緩沖區讀取數據。為了保證緩沖區的正確使用,需要使用信號量進行同步。那么,應該設置的信號量數量以及初始值分別為()A.1個,0B.1個,1C.2個,0D.2個,112、在一個實時操作系統中,任務的調度不僅要考慮任務的優先級,還要滿足任務的時間約束。假設有一個周期性任務,其執行周期為50毫秒,每次執行時間為20毫秒。分析在不同的調度算法(如單調速率調度、最早截止時間優先等)下,如何保證該任務能夠按時完成,并討論這些調度算法在處理周期性任務時的優缺點。A.單調速率調度算法最優B.最早截止時間優先算法最優C.兩種算法在不同情況下各有優劣D.取決于任務的具體特點和系統負載13、在計算機操作系統中,進程管理是核心功能之一。以下關于進程狀態的描述中,哪個選項是錯誤的?()A.就緒狀態表示進程已經準備好執行,但還需要等待CPU分配時間片B.運行狀態表示進程正在CPU上執行C.阻塞狀態表示進程因為等待某個事件而暫停執行D.終止狀態表示進程已經完成執行,但還占用系統資源14、在一個采用位示圖進行磁盤空間管理的操作系統中,磁盤共有1000個物理塊,位示圖中每個字長為32位。那么,位示圖需要占用多少個磁盤塊來存儲?()A.10B.11C.32D.3315、某磁盤的轉速為7200轉/分鐘,平均尋道時間為8ms,每個磁道包含1000個扇區,傳輸速率為50MB/s。若要讀取一個50MB的文件,其平均訪問時間約為多少?(請給出詳細的計算過程)()A.18.4msB.20.4msC.22.4msD.24.4ms16、操作系統的內核是系統的核心部分,負責管理系統的資源和提供基本的服務。以下關于內核的描述中,哪個選項是錯誤的?()A.內核可以分為微內核和宏內核兩種類型,微內核結構更加靈活,但性能較低B.內核的主要功能包括進程管理、內存管理、文件系統管理和設備管理等C.內核可以直接訪問硬件資源,但需要通過驅動程序來實現對設備的控制D.內核是操作系統中唯一運行在特權模式下的部分,其他部分都運行在用戶模式下17、在一個具有進程同步機制的操作系統中,有兩個進程P和Q,它們共享一個緩沖區。P進程負責向緩沖區寫入數據,Q進程負責從緩沖區讀取數據。為了保證數據的正確讀寫,使用了一個信號量S,初始值為1。當P進程準備向緩沖區寫入數據時,執行P(S)操作;寫入完成后,執行V(S)操作。當Q進程準備從緩沖區讀取數據時,執行P(S)操作;讀取完成后,執行V(S)操作。假設當前Q進程正在讀取數據,P進程準備寫入數據。那么,P進程會處于什么狀態?()A.就緒狀態B.阻塞狀態C.運行狀態D.掛起狀態18、在操作系統的設備驅動程序中,負責與硬件設備進行通信和控制。假設一個設備驅動程序需要處理設備的中斷請求。以下關于中斷處理的描述,正確的是:()A.設備中斷發生時,操作系統會立即暫停當前正在執行的進程,轉去處理中斷B.中斷處理程序的執行時間應該盡量短,以免影響系統的實時性C.設備驅動程序在處理中斷時,可以阻塞其他設備的中斷請求D.中斷處理完成后,操作系統會自動選擇一個高優先級的進程進行調度執行19、操作系統的安全機制可以保護系統的資源和數據不被非法訪問和破壞。以下關于操作系統安全機制的描述中,哪個選項是錯誤的?()A.操作系統可以采用用戶認證和授權機制來控制用戶對系統資源的訪問B.操作系統可以采用加密技術來保護文件和數據的安全C.操作系統可以采用訪問控制列表(ACL)來實現對文件和目錄的訪問控制D.操作系統的安全機制只需要在軟件層面實現,不需要考慮硬件設備的安全性20、文件系統是操作系統中用于管理文件的重要組成部分。假設一個文件系統采用多級目錄結構,文件的物理存儲采用連續分配方式。當用戶創建一個新文件時,以下關于文件系統操作的描述中,正確的是:()A.文件系統首先在目錄中為新文件創建一個條目,然后在磁盤上為其分配連續的存儲空間B.由于采用連續分配方式,文件系統需要從頭開始查找足夠的連續空間來存儲新文件C.文件系統會為新文件隨機分配存儲空間,然后更新目錄中的文件信息D.連續分配方式會導致文件的擴展非常困難,所以文件系統通常會拒絕創建較大的新文件21、操作系統的進程通信機制可以實現不同進程之間的數據交換和同步。以下關于進程通信的描述中,哪個選項是錯誤的?()A.進程通信可以分為共享內存、消息傳遞和管道等方式B.共享內存方式速度快,但需要解決同步和互斥問題C.消息傳遞方式比較靈活,但開銷較大D.管道是一種單向通信方式,只能用于父子進程之間的通信22、在一個具有三級頁表的分頁存儲系統中,頁面大小為4KB,邏輯地址空間為64GB。若各級頁表的長度均為4B,則頁表占用的內存空間是多少?(給出詳細的計算步驟)()A.4MBB.8MBC.16MBD.32MB23、某操作系統中,有三個并發進程P1、P2和P3,都需要使用同類資源R,每個進程需要的資源數分別為3、4和5。系統共有10個該類資源。若采用銀行家算法,當進程P1申請1個資源時,系統是否會為其分配資源?(請詳細分析)()A.會B.不會C.不確定D.以上都不對24、在一個采用先來先服務(FCFS)磁盤調度算法的系統中,假設磁盤請求隊列的順序為98,183,37,122,14,124,65,67。磁頭初始位置在53磁道,磁頭移動方向從0磁道開始向磁道號增加的方向移動,請問磁頭移動的總距離是多少?()A.565B.649C.708D.75625、在文件系統中,文件的存儲方式有連續存儲、鏈式存儲和索引存儲等。假設一個文件系統主要處理大文件的存儲和訪問。以下關于存儲方式選擇的描述,正確的是:()A.連續存儲適合大文件,因為可以快速定位文件數據,讀寫效率高B.鏈式存儲可以充分利用磁盤空間,適合存儲大文件C.索引存儲會增加文件的存儲空間開銷,不適合大文件存儲D.對于大文件,應該隨機選擇一種存儲方式,性能差異不大二、簡答題(本大題共4個小題,共20分)1、(本題5分)進程調度算法的性能評價指標有哪些?2、(本題5分)什么是進程的上下文切換?其開銷有哪些?3、(本題5分)簡述操作系統的性能指標和影響因素。4、(本題5分)解釋分布式文件系統的架構和工作原理。三、綜合分析題(本大題共5個小題,共25分)1、(本題5分)研究操作系統中的內存管理的內存泄漏的運行時檢測工具。2、(本題5分)探討操作系統如何處理進程間通信中的消息傳遞的異步和同步模式。3、(本題5分)研究操作系統如何實現對文件系統的快速備份和恢復功能。4、(本題5分)研究操作系統中的虛擬內存管理的大內存頁的分配策略。5、(本題5分)分析操作系統中的文件系統的目錄索引優化技術。四、論述題(本大題共3個小題,共30分)1、(本題10分

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論